What is Panel Restoration?


Panel remediation refers to the procedure of fixing, refurbishing, and revitalizing numerous kinds of panels used in structures— inside and out. These might include wall panels, ceiling panels, or even cladding. The objective is to restore these aspects to their original condition or enhance their look to extend their life expectancy, enhance energy performance, and maintain home worth.

The Panel Restoration Process


The panel remediation process can vary depending upon the kind of panels being treated, but it usually follows a comparable series of steps:

  1. Assessment: Experts evaluate the condition of the panels to figure out the extent of damage and appropriate remediation techniques.

  2. Cleaning: Panels are completely cleaned to eliminate dirt, grime, and any other impurities. This step may involve pressure washing or using specialized cleaning up agents.

  3. Repairs: Any damaged locations are fixed by replacing or fixing private pieces, including filling fractures, replacing damaged sections, or strengthening vulnerable points.

  4. Ending up Touches: After repair, panels might need treatment with sealants, paints, or discolorations to restore their protective and aesthetic qualities.

  5. Final Inspection: An extensive inspection is performed to make sure that all work has been completed satisfactorily and that panels meet quality standards.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)


1. How do I understand if my panels require repair?

Signs that panels might require remediation include visible damage (cracks, warping, or discoloration), peeling paint, indications of mold, or if they are no longer offering adequate insulation.

2. The length of time does the remediation procedure take?

The duration of the repair procedure can vary based on the level of damage, the type of panels, and the approaches utilized. Minor repairs can take a few days, while extensive work might take weeks.

3. Can I restore panels myself?
